Description
This reference book features the characterization and application of endoglycosidases. The monograph, which covers most of the endoglycosidases that act on glycoconjugates, is authored mainly by those researchers who discovered them. To assist students in obtaining a better understanding of the enzymes, the book also provides a general introduction to sugars and enzymes as well as the stories of their discovery.
Reviews / Votes
From the reviews:"This concise and useful book is the product of 19 contributors with expertise in a number of chemical and biological areas and reviews the diverse possibilities for the application of glycobiological techniques towards the understanding of physiological processes. . The explanations are clear and concise and are accompanied by useful figures and detailed traces, etc. . The book is better written and more comprehensive . and should be part of the library of any serious glycobiologist." (Robin Polt, Journal of the American Chemical Society, Vol. 130 (9), 2008)More details
